DU JAT Selection Procedure 2021: Delhi University annually conducts DUET 2021 (Delhi University Entrance Test 2021) to shortlist candidates for admission to professional courses like Bachelor of Management Studies (BMS), and eight other colleges which offer B. A (Hons) in Business Economics and BBA (FIA). DUET is an online computer-based exam consisting of two hours and is conducted across 18 Indian cities. DUET 2021 selection process is done after the entrance exam is successfully conducted. Candidates who stand eligible for the DU JAT selection process or who clear the required DUET cutoff will be called for the stages of the admission process of DU JAT.
